The Save Dreamland Campaign was launched by Joyland Books in January 2003 and is now supported by several thousand people. This is the place to discuss all aspects of saving Margate's famous amusement park and its iconic , Grade II listed Scenic Railway, Britain's oldest roller coaster.

You tried running in compatibility mode? Thats how i did it last time i played ^^

To run compatibility mode right click the roller coaster tycoon icon, select properties, then the compatibility tab. Check off the run this program in compatibility mode, then select your desired Operating system.
